AGR3 (Anterior Gradient 3)
Protein disulfide isomerase family member with roles in mucin production and cancer

Description
AGR3 encodes a member of the protein disulfide isomerase (PDI) family, localized to the endoplasmic reticulum. It is involved in oxidative protein folding and is highly expressed in mucin-secreting epithelial cells. AGR3 is upregulated in several cancers, including breast and ovarian, and may serve as a biomarker for tumor progression.
Disease Associations
| Disease category | Pathophysiological mechanism | Genomic evidence |
|---|---|---|
| Breast cancer | Overexpression of AGR3 in estrogen receptor-positive tumors; may promote cell survival and chemoresistance | PMID: 21947068 |
| Ovarian cancer | Elevated AGR3 expression in serous ovarian carcinoma; associated with poor prognosis | PMID: 23104868 |
| Mucinous adenocarcinoma | AGR3 is a marker of mucinous differentiation in various tissues | PMID: 19074856 |

Protein Summary
AGR3 is a 166-amino acid protein with a thioredoxin-like domain characteristic of PDI family members. It catalyzes disulfide bond formation and rearrangement during protein folding. AGR3 is secreted and can be detected in serum, making it a potential biomarker for mucinous tumors.
